Born in Dearborn, Michigan, the '67 Mustang is the car that made "pony car" a household term. With its long hood, short rear deck, and that unmistakable fastback roofline, it rewrote American muscle forever. Fun fact: the Mustang was so popular that Ford sold over a million units in its first two years — a sales record that still stands for any new car nameplate.
